Media Studies

What is agenda-setting theory?

Tap to flip
ANSWER

Proposed by McCombs and Shaw (1972): the media doesn't tell people what to think, but what to think about. By choosing which stories to cover and how prominently, media shapes the public agenda and perceived importance of issues. First-level: which topics matter. Second-level: which attributes of those topics matter (framing).
